copying is supposed to be the easy part. then the useful thing gets replaced, the remote desktop refuses Ctrl+V, or the secret you copied becomes something you would rather not leave lying around. klipd gives the clipboard a memory and a little judgement.
keep recent text, rich text, HTML, images, and file lists in a searchable local history. pin the pieces you reach for often.
when a Citrix, RDP, VNC, KVM, or support session will not accept the clipboard, klipd can deliver the selected text one keystroke at a time.
no sync service and no telemetry. password-manager exclusion formats are respected; sensitive clips can be masked, protected, and kept out of search.
klipd watches the clipboard locally and holds on to the copy that would normally be gone after your next Ctrl+C.
search, pin, or choose from the tray applet. the history stays out of the way until the moment it earns its place.
send it back to the clipboard, paste it into your last app, or use a paced typing preset when the destination has paste locked down.
